Marks on the glass tube reduce the service

life of the bulbs. Do not touch the glass tube

with your bare hands. If necessary, clean the

glass tube when cold with alcohol or spirit and

rub it off with a lint-free cloth.
Protect bulbs from moisture during

operation. Do not allow bulbs to come into

contact with liquids.

Overview: changing bulbs/bulb types

Halogen headlamps
:

Low-beam headlamp: H7 55 W

;

High-beam headlamp: H7 55 W

=

Turn signal lamp: PY 21 W

Bi-Xenon headlamps
:

Cornering lamp: H7 55 W

Tail lamp
:

Backup lamp: W 16 W
